the cusco bar should fit fine if you got the right model. most of them are direct bolt-ins like apex-i and dont have lenght adjustments, because length adjustments compromise the rigidity of the car.

as for the BOX car..well..its an OBX...what did you expect? just adjust the length until it fits, if its adjustable...otherwise contact the company.-chet
